IP查询
查询
你查询的IP:[120.137.14.89] 地理位置:中国–上海–上海佰隆网络
最新查询
60.88.219.237
218.159.1.108
60.114.55.195
221.64.25.127
218.89.52.245
119.12.48.177
60.115.32.225
120.65.206.52
120.61.212.43
120.137.14.89
122.144.128.83
119.80.241.105
202.124.24.128
121.16.54.147
58.100.224.160
118.230.58.140
119.164.34.117
121.76.31.97
123.177.56.84
202.4.128.73
210.79.64.28
134.196.163.148
202.38.149.119
121.40.140.85
58.14.230.197
61.45.128.163
202.131.208.200
121.48.181.82
121.59.151.151
203.91.32.245
210.32.144.228